Part 1: Understanding Robinhood's Cryptocurrency Offerings
1.1 What Cryptocurrencies are Available on Robinhood?
Robinhood offers trading in several popular c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), Bitcoin Cash (BCH), and Dogecoin (DOGE).
1.2 How Does Robinhood Store Cryptocurrency?
Robinhood stores its customers' cryptocurrency in cold storage wallets, which are offline and secured to prevent hacking and theft.
Part 2: Withdrawing Cryptocurrency from Robinhood
2.1 How to Withdraw Cryptocurrency from Robinhood
Step 1: Log in to your Robinhood account.
Step 2: Navigate to the "Account" section on the left-hand menu.
Step 3: Select "Settings."
Step 4: Choose "Withdrawal" from the available options.
Step 5: Select "Crypto" from the withdrawal types.
Step 6: Enter the amount you wish to withdraw.
Step 7: Enter the wallet address of the cryptocurrency you want to withdraw to.
Step 8: Review the transaction details and confirm the withdrawal.
2.2 Things to Consider Before Withdrawing Cryptocurrency
a. Transaction Fees: Be aware that there may be network fees associated with sending cryptocurrency to your wallet.
b. Withdrawal Time: It may take a few minutes to a few hours for the withdrawal to be processed, depending on the cryptocurrency and network congestion.
c. Limits: Robinhood may have withdrawal limits in place, which you should be aware of before initiating a withdrawal.

Part 4: Security and Privacy Concerns
4.1 Is It Safe to Withdraw Cryptocurrency from Robinhood?
Yes, it is generally safe to withdraw cryptocurrency from Robinhood, as the platform uses cold storage to store most of its users' funds. However, it is crucial to ensure that you are using a secure wallet address when withdrawing to prevent losing your cryptocurrency.
4.2 How to Protect Your Cryptocurrency
Always keep your private keys secure and never share them with anyone. Additionally, consider using two-factor authentication (2FA) and a strong password to protect your Robinhood account.
Part 5: Common Questions and Answers
Q1: Can I withdraw my cryptocurrency from Robinhood at any time?
A1: Yes, you can withdraw your cryptocurrency from Robinhood at any time, as long as your account is in good standing and you meet the withdrawal requirements.
Q2: How long does it take to withdraw cryptocurrency from Robinhood?
A2: The withdrawal time can vary, but it typically takes a few minutes to a few hours, depending on the cryptocurrency and network congestion.
Q3: Can I withdraw my entire cryptocurrency balance from Robinhood?
A3: Yes, you can withdraw your entire cryptocurrency balance from Robinhood, as long as you meet the withdrawal requirements and the balance is available in your account.
Q4: Are there any withdrawal fees associated with Robinhood?
A4: Robinhood does not charge any withdrawal fees for transferring cryptocurrency to your wallet. However, there may be network fees associated with the transaction.
